Dublin

Nothing beats a walking tour To get to know a city, To learn about the pretty spots As well as those quite gritty. In Dublin, with a guide named Rex, We zipped along the streets And laughed a lot while learning of Its cool historic treats. And then to a museum, An exhibit of Vermeer. How fortunate it was displayed While on our visit here. This all was on 2 hours sleep But still, we plodded on. A Guinness and some fish and chips Until our strength was gone. In bed at 6! But rested now, My mind anticipates The coming day with much to see - A new adventure waits.
